| Unified process - | (Software Engineering) a "use-case driven, architecture-centric, iterative and incremental" software process that emphasizes the use of UML notation |
| Unit testing - | (Software Engineering) part of the testing strategy that focuses on tests to individual program components |
| Usability - | An informal measure of the ease with which a user interface can be learned and applied with efficiency and without errors |
| Use-case - | (Software Engineering) a written description that defines a very specific interaction between a user and a system, often (but not always) written in the form of a usage scenario |
| User - | (Software Engineering) the person who actually used to software or the product that has software embedded within it |
| User hierarchy - | (Software Engineering) a hierarchical representation of the categories of users that will interact with any type of software |
| User-story - | (Software Engineering) a usage scenario that is used as part of Extreme programming |
| Validation - | (Software Engineering) tests to ensure that the software conforms to its requirements |
| WebApps (Web Applications) - | (Software Engineering) any application that delivers meaningful content or functionality to end users via the Web. |
| Web engineering - | (Software Engineering) the application of software engineering principles, concepts, and methods (or adaptations of them) to the development of Web-based applications or systems. |
